Ok I got my S4 N/A Running again all it needed was a new set of plugs and wires and fired right up. Now my question is can an engine be out of balance? The reason I ask is becuase my engine or what ever it may be started to make this vibration starting at around 5500 RPM that gets so bad coming up to 7000 RPM that I dont reach 7K and I have to let go of the shifter **** cause of how bad it gets. But then again it does it on and off. like out of 4 7k pulls 1 time it will do it. A mechanically inclined friend of mine told me it could be your tranny mount or your engiine mounts. any one got any ideas?

Check the transmission cross member mount, it can create a huge vibration. The rubber bushing area should be one piece and attached to the metal cross member bar. takes about .5 to 1 hour to remove it.
